Stuarts Draft, VA Radon Mitigation and Testing
Nestled in Augusta County in Virginia's Shenandoah Valley, Stuarts Draft is positioned on valley floor sediments and limestone bedrock that can influence radon gas movement and accumulation. The community features a mix of valley housing styles, including both traditional and contemporary homes with various foundation types. With testing data currently limited for zip code 24477, homeowners should prioritize radon testing to understand their individual exposure risk in this valley setting.

Stuarts Draft Radon Facts
Key details about the radon risk profile for Stuarts Draft and the 24477 zip code area.
Stuarts Draft and the 24477 zip code are located in Augusta County, which has an EPA assigned Radon Zone of 1. A radon zone of 1 predicts an average indoor radon screening level greater than 4 pCi/L. The EPA recommends testing every home regardless of zone classification.
